#1f63ec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f63ec is composed of 12.2% red, 38.8%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.9% cyan, 58.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 220.1 degrees, a saturation of 84.4% and a lightness of 52.4%. #1f63ec color hex could be obtained by blending #3ec6ff with #0000d9. Closest websafe color is: #3366ff.

#1f63ec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f63ec has RGB values of R:31, G:99, B:236 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0.58, Y:0,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 2057196.

Shades and Tints of #1f63ec
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01040b is the darkest color, while #f8fafe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f63ec
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c828f is the less saturated color, while #0c5dff is the most saturated one.
